Konami's Sengoku Collection Social Game Gets TV Anime (Updated)
posted on by Egan Loo
Female re-imagining of famous warlords in anime version

The anime's main character is a female re-imagining of the great warlord Oda Nobunaga (pictured below right). Another major character is the female version of Tokugawa Ieyasu (pictured top left), the first shogun of Japan.
Konami now claims the Sengoku Collection game has a user base of more than 2.5 million.

Update 3: The official website has been updated with the following staff list:
Director: Keiji Gotoh
Music Director: Yō Yamada
Script Supervisor: Shijūrō Mitaka
Character Design: Katsunori Shibata
Animation Production: Brains Base
Production: NAS
